C/C++数组操作程序实现与探讨
版权申诉
57 浏览量
更新于2024-11-11
收藏 369KB RAR 举报
资源摘要信息: "本资源包含了使用C或C++语言编写的数组元音程序代码和编译后的可执行文件。"
知识点详细说明:
1. 数组概念:
在C或C++中,数组是一系列相同类型数据的有序集合。数组可以是基本数据类型,如int、char、float等,也可以是复合数据类型,例如结构体或联合体。数组中的每个数据称为数组元素,每个元素可以通过其索引(位置号)进行访问。数组的索引通常从0开始。
2. C/C++数组声明与初始化:
在C或C++中声明数组需要指定数组类型、数组名和数组的大小。例如,声明一个整型数组可以写为 `int myArray[10];`。数组也可以在声明时进行初始化,例如 `int myArray[3] = {1, 2, 3};`。未显式初始化的数组元素会被自动初始化为0。
3. C/C++程序中的数组操作:
在C/C++程序中,数组的常见操作包括遍历、搜索、插入、删除和排序等。遍历数组通常通过循环结构(如for或while循环)完成。数组元素可以通过索引直接访问和修改。
4. C/C++元音字母处理:
在本资源中,"数组元音"可能指的是用数组来处理和存储元音字母。元音字母通常指的是在英语中的五个字母a, e, i, o, u(有时y也会被当作元音字母)。程序可能会涉及到对这些元音字母进行排序、计数、查找等操作。
5. C/C++编译过程:
C/C++源代码文件通常以“.cpp”扩展名保存,并在编译后生成可执行文件,扩展名为“.exe”在Windows操作系统上。编译过程会通过编译器将高级语言代码转换为机器语言。对于本资源,源代码文件名为“array_vokal.cpp”,编译后生成的可执行文件名为“array_vokal.exe”。
6. C/C++程序开发实践:
使用数组处理元音字母,是C/C++编程中的一项基础练习。这通常出现在编程入门教程中,有助于初学者理解数组的使用、循环控制结构以及基本的输入输出操作。此外,它也教会了用户如何操作和处理字符串,因为元音字母通常是从字符串中提取出来的。
7. C/C++编程环境要求:
为运行此程序,用户需要在计算机上安装C或C++的编译环境,如GCC、Clang、MSVC等。之后,用户可以使用命令行编译器或集成开发环境(IDE)如Visual Studio、Code::Blocks等来编译“array_vokal.cpp”文件,并运行生成的“array_vokal.exe”程序。
8. 示例程序逻辑分析:
虽然没有提供具体的代码,但根据标题“array_vokal_array_various6fx_”和描述“array vokal program using c / c++”,可以推测这个程序可能包含了以下逻辑:创建一个数组来存储元音字母,然后可能实现一个算法来识别、计数或修改这些字母。例如,程序可以要求用户输入一个单词,然后找出并显示该单词中所有元音字母的数量,或者将它们按特定的顺序排序。
9. 程序扩展性:
此类程序可以轻松扩展到其他方面,例如,处理所有字母、查找特定字母、实现字符计数或构建一个字母频率分析器等。在学习编程的早期阶段,通过此类练习可以加深对数组处理、条件判断和循环控制结构的理解。
总结而言,这个压缩包中的内容提供了一个基础的编程实例,用于说明如何在C/C++程序中处理数组和元音字母。通过学习这个示例,初学者能够掌握数组的使用方法和基本的程序结构,为进一步学习更复杂的编程概念打下坚实的基础。
2021-06-11 上传
2017-03-13 上传
2024-11-14 上传
2024-11-14 上传
何欣颜
- 粉丝: 80
- 资源: 4730
最新资源
- 高清艺术文字图标资源,PNG和ICO格式免费下载
- mui框架HTML5应用界面组件使用示例教程
- Vue.js开发利器:chrome-vue-devtools插件解析
- 掌握ElectronBrowserJS:打造跨平台电子应用
- 前端导师教程:构建与部署社交证明页面
- Java多线程与线程安全在断点续传中的实现
- 免Root一键卸载安卓预装应用教程
- 易语言实现高级表格滚动条完美控制技巧
- 超声波测距尺的源码实现
- 数据可视化与交互:构建易用的数据界面
- 实现Discourse外聘回复自动标记的简易插件
- 链表的头插法与尾插法实现及长度计算
- Playwright与Typescript及Mocha集成:自动化UI测试实践指南
- 128x128像素线性工具图标下载集合
- 易语言安装包程序增强版:智能导入与重复库过滤
- 利用AJAX与Spotify API在Google地图中探索世界音乐排行榜